Hi @Saneeta Galbow , thanks for your explanation.
If you have the Timeline enabled in your instance, it should mean you can also have a custom issue hierarchy, where you can create another level above the Epics for your Mega Epics.
As you can see here, I was able to obtain the configuration of a Mega Epic that has other Epics under it.
The only thing I would say about the custom issue hierarchy is that it is a global configuration, for the whole instance, so you will need to evaluate if this will interfere with the work that anyone else is doing.
